Fargo Legislative District Names New Representative

(North Dakota Monitor) – The Fargo legislative district that had been served by Rep. Josh Christy has named a replacement.

The Republican Party in District 27 unanimously elected Timothy “TJ” Brown to fill the House seat.

Christy died Feb. 18.

Brown will begin his legislative session in Bismarck on Wednesday. His term ends in 2026.

Brown lives in the Osgood area of south Fargo. He owns The Range, a virtual gun range and training business, and Tea Party Solutions, a firearms training company and podcast.

Brown is an Army veteran and former West Fargo police officer.

Brown said his priorities include anti-abortion policies, supporting the Second Amendment and lowering taxes.
